Royals at White Sox game has been postponed by rain

CHICAGO — The Kansas City Royals' game at the Chicago White Sox has been postponed because of rain. It will be made up on Wednesday afternoon as part of a straight doubleheader. Kansas City beat Chicago 2-0 in the series opener on Monday night. White Sox right-hander Jonathan Cannon takes the mound in the doubleheader opener for his big league debut. Right-hander Brady Singer starts for the Royals. Kansas City right-hander Michael Wacha and Chicago right-hander Erick Fedde pitch in the second game.
